Save
Poster Nature Ecology, PNG, 3104x2878px, Poster, Ball, Banner, Color, Ecology Download Free
User fcirytails uploaded this Green Earth Window - Poster Nature Ecology PNG PNG image on April 23, 2017, 2:32 pm. The resolution of this file is 3104x2878px and its file size is: 7.93 MB. This PNG image is filed under the tags:
Download PNG (7.93 MB)

Green Earth Window - Poster Nature Ecology PNG

Edit PNG
AI Background Remover
3104x2878
7.93 MB
April 23, 2017
PNG (300 DPI)